Building a Strong Online Presence with a Business Website

If you want customers to find you, you need a website. It’s often the first thing people check before making a purchase. In fact, more than 80% of consumers research businesses online before deciding to buy. That means if you don’t have a well-optimized website, you could be missing out on a huge chunk of potential customers.

Your website does a lot more than just showcase your products or services. It builds trust, helps people understand your brand, and acts as a 24/7 digital storefront. Whether you’re running a local business, an e-commerce store, or offering services, a website lets customers connect with you anytime, anywhere.

The good news? Setting up a business website has never been easier. Platforms like Shopify, Wix, and WordPress make it possible for anyone to create a professional site—no coding experience required.

  • Shopify is a great choice for e-commerce businesses since it comes with built-in payment processing, inventory management, and easy-to-use store layouts.
  • Wix works well for small businesses and service providers, offering an intuitive drag-and-drop interface for customization.
  • WordPress is perfect for scalability and SEO optimization, making it a solid choice for businesses looking for long-term growth and flexibility.

A strong business website should have:

  • A clear homepage that highlights your brand’s unique value.
  • An about us page that tells your story and builds trust.
  • A products/services page that features your offerings with high-quality images and compelling descriptions.
  • A contact page that makes it easy for customers to get in touch.
  • A blog or resources section that positions your brand as an expert in your field.

If you’re running a local business, don’t forget to optimize your Google My Business listing. Keeping your contact details, location, and customer reviews up to date helps improve your visibility in local search results, making it easier for potential customers to find you.

Leveraging Social Media for Business Growth

Social media has completely changed how businesses interact with their customers. It’s one of the most powerful marketing tools available today, giving brands a direct way to engage with audiences, build awareness, and drive sales. But not all platforms work for every business—it’s important to choose the right ones based on your industry and target audience.

For e-commerce, fashion, beauty, and lifestyle brands, Instagram and TikTok are the go-to platforms. They focus on visual content, short-form videos, and interactive engagement, making them great for showcasing products and working with influencers.

If you’re targeting a broader audience, Facebook is still a major player. It offers powerful advertising tools, community-building features through groups, and live streaming to connect with customers in real-time.

For B2B businesses, consultants, and service providers, LinkedIn is the best option. It’s where professionals share insights, build credibility, and connect with potential business partners.

To get the most out of social media, businesses should:

  • Post high-quality content consistently (photos, videos, reels, carousels).
  • Engage with followers through comments, polls, and Q&A sessions.
  • Use relevant hashtags to expand reach and attract new audiences.
  • Schedule posts using tools like Buffer, Hootsuite, or Later for efficient social media management.

Using Paid Advertising to Expand Customer Reach

While organic marketing is great, paid advertising can help you scale faster. Platforms like Facebook Ads, Instagram Ads, and Google Ads let you target specific demographics, driving more traffic to your website or online store.

Facebook and Instagram Ads allow businesses to target users based on age, interests, behavior, and location. These platforms offer carousel ads, video ads, and collection ads, which work well for showcasing products and getting customers to convert.

Google Ads is perfect for businesses that want to capture high-intent customers. Search ads appear at the top of Google results, helping businesses rank above competitors for specific keywords. Display ads and YouTube ads provide additional ways to reach potential customers across different online platforms.

To maximize your advertising budget, businesses should:

  • A/B test different ad creatives to see what performs best.
  • Analyze performance metrics to refine campaigns.
  • Use retargeting ads to re-engage past visitors and increase conversions.

When combined with a strong organic marketing strategy, paid ads can accelerate growth and help businesses reach more customers faster.

Optimizing for Search Engines (SEO) to Drive Organic Traffic

SEO is one of the most cost-effective ways to attract customers in the long run. A well-optimized website can rank higher on Google, making it easier for potential customers to find you without relying on paid ads.

There are several aspects to SEO optimization, including:

  • Keyword Optimization – Using relevant search terms throughout your website.
  • On-Page SEO – Optimizing title tags, meta descriptions, headers, and URLs.
  • Technical SEO – Improving website speed, mobile responsiveness, and security (SSL encryption).
  • Content Marketing – Creating valuable blog posts, guides, and case studies that attract and inform customers.

For local businesses, Google My Business optimization and positive customer reviews can help improve local search rankings, making your business more visible to customers in your area.

Building Credibility Through Influencer Collaborations

Influencer marketing is one of the most effective ways to build trust and increase brand visibility. By working with social media influencers, bloggers, and industry experts, businesses can tap into an engaged audience that’s already interested in their niche.

To run a successful influencer campaign:

  • Choose influencers whose audience matches your target market.
  • Focus on micro-influencers (10K–100K followers) for higher engagement.
  • Partner with influencers for product reviews, unboxing videos, and giveaways.

Retaining Customers and Building Brand Loyalty

Attracting new customers is important, but retaining them is even more valuable. Customer retention strategies like email marketing, loyalty programs, and personalized customer service help businesses build long-term relationships with their audience.

Great retention strategies include:

  • Sending exclusive discounts, product updates, and personalized content via email.
  • Offering reward programs where customers earn points for purchases and referrals.
  • Providing quick response times and excellent after-sales support.

Happy customers are more likely to return, refer friends, and leave positive reviews, all of which help drive sustainable business growth.

What is AEO (Answer Engine Optimization), and why does it matter?2025-03-18T13:47:59+08:00

AEO (Answer Engine Optimization) is the process of optimizing content to appear in featured snippets, voice search results, and AI-generated responses on search engines like Google and Bing. Unlike traditional SEO, AEO focuses on providing direct, concise, and authoritative answers to user queries. By optimizing for AEO, businesses can increase visibility in zero-click searches, voice assistants, and AI-powered chatbots, making it easier for potential customers to find quick and relevant information.

How can I measure if my marketing strategies are working?2025-03-18T13:47:47+08:00

Use analytics tools like Google Analytics, Facebook Insights, and Instagram Business Suite to track website traffic, engagement rates, ad performance, and customer conversions. Key metrics to monitor include click-through rates (CTR), cost per acquisition (CPA), and return on investment (ROI) to assess the effectiveness of your marketing efforts.
